ocx编程有什么用

不及物动词 其他 32

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    OCX编程是一种用于开发组件化软件的技术,它可以为应用程序提供丰富的功能和交互性。主要用途如下:

    1. 自定义用户界面:OCX(Object Linking and Embedding Custom Controls)可以用来创建自定义的用户界面控件,如按钮、菜单、对话框等。通过OCX编程,开发人员可以根据自己的需求,设计出独特、美观且具有交互性的用户界面。

    2. 增强应用程序功能:OCX可以提供一些特定的功能组件,如图像处理、数据库访问、网络通信等,使应用程序具备更丰富的功能。通过使用OCX编程,开发人员可以利用已有的OCX控件,快速实现应用程序的功能扩展。

    3. 提高代码的重用性:OCX编程允许把功能组件以独立的方式开发,并将其作为可重用的模块供其他应用程序使用。这样可降低开发人员的工作量,加快软件开发速度。

    4. 简化程序维护和升级:使用OCX编程开发应用程序时,开发人员可以将常用的功能组件抽取出来,作为独立的OCX控件。当需要修改或升级这些功能时,只需要对相应的OCX控件进行修改,而不需要修改整个应用程序的代码。这样可以极大地简化程序的维护工作。

    总之,OCX编程提供了一种灵活、可扩展的开发方式,可以使应用程序具备更丰富的功能和更好的用户体验。它在软件开发中具有很大的应用前景和市场需求。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    OCX编程(ActiveX控件编程)是一种基于Microsoft技术的可重用二进制组件编程模型,用于开发和实现Windows平台上的应用程序。OCX编程有以下几个用途:

    1. 创建自定义用户界面:使用OCX控件可以创建自定义的用户界面,让用户能够更方便地与应用程序进行交互。OCX控件具有丰富的功能和灵活的界面设计,可用于创建按钮、文本框、下拉列表等各种用户界面元素。

    2. 实现功能模块的代码复用:通过OCX编程,可以将一些常用的功能模块以控件的形式封装起来,方便在不同的应用程序中重用。这样可以大大提高开发效率,减少代码冗余,同时也方便维护和升级。

    3. 与其他应用程序进行交互:OCX控件可以通过COM(组件对象模型)接口实现与其他应用程序的交互。通过OCX编程,可以在自己的应用程序中嵌入其他应用程序的控件,实现数据的共享和交换,提高应用程序的功能和扩展性。

    4. 实现复杂的数据处理和算法:OCX编程可以利用底层的Windows API和其他开发工具,实现一些复杂的数据处理和算法。通过编程技术,可以高效地处理数据,提高应用程序的性能和响应速度,同时还可以实现一些高级的功能,如图像处理、网络通信等。

    5. 开发专门的控件和插件:OCX编程可以用于开发独立的控件和插件,供其他开发者在他们的应用程序中使用。这样可以为其他开发者提供一些特定的功能和工具,丰富应用程序的功能和用户体验。

    综上所述,OCX编程具有广泛的应用领域,可以用于开发各种类型的应用程序,为开发者提供丰富的功能和工具。无论是创建自定义用户界面、实现功能模块的代码复用,还是与其他应用程序进行交互,OCX编程都是非常有用的开发技术。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    OCX(Object Linking and Embedding Control,对象链接和嵌入控件)是一种基于Windows平台的可重用软件组件,用于开发定制的应用程序。OCX编程有以下几个用途:

    1. 创建定制的用户界面:OCX可以作为一个可视化控件,嵌入到应用程序的用户界面中,用于实现各种交互功能。例如,可以使用OCX实现图表控件、文本编辑控件、图像显示控件等,为应用程序提供丰富的用户界面。

    2. 实现特定功能:OCX可以提供特定的功能模块,如数据库操作、网络通信、文件处理等。通过使用这些OCX控件,开发者可以快速实现某些常见功能,避免重复编写代码。

    3. 实现插件功能:利用OCX编程,可以将某些特定功能封装成OCX控件,供其他开发者使用。其他开发者可以将这些OCX控件作为插件添加到自己的应用程序中,实现特定的扩展功能,提高开发效率。

    4. 提供外部接口:OCX控件可以通过提供外部接口(API)的方式,供其他应用程序调用。这样,其他应用程序就可以直接使用OCX中封装的功能,与OCX进行交互,实现数据的传递和共享。

    OCX编程常用的开发语言包括Visual Basic(VB)、C++等。在编程过程中,需要调用OCX控件的方法、属性和事件,通过操作流程实现控件的初始化、显示、交互等功能。

    在具体使用OCX编程时,可以按照以下步骤进行操作:

    1. 导入OCX:将OCX控件添加到项目中。可以通过拖拽的方式将OCX控件添加到视图或窗口中,或者使用代码导入。

    2. 配置属性:根据需要,设置OCX控件的属性,如尺寸、位置、颜色等。可以通过代码设置属性,也可以通过属性窗口进行配置。

    3. 调用方法:通过调用OCX控件的方法,来实现特定的功能。调用方法的方式有多种,可以通过代码调用,也可以通过用户界面上的按钮、菜单等触发。

    4. 响应事件:如果需要处理控件的某些事件,可以编写事件处理函数,并将其与控件的相应事件关联起来。当事件发生时,会执行相应的事件处理函数,实现相应的功能。

    5. 销毁控件:在应用程序退出或不再需要使用OCX控件的时候,需要销毁控件,释放相关资源。可以通过代码销毁控件,或者在应用程序退出时自动销毁。

    总之,OCX编程是一种方便灵活的开发方式,可以快速实现定制应用程序的功能,提高开发效率和应用程序的性能。通过合理使用OCX控件,可以加速软件开发过程,实现更丰富、更灵活的用户界面和功能。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部